Abstract
Highly capable airborne optical imaging systems have been developed recently for obtaining high-resolution and spectral data on potential targets, to provide high area-coverage rates and automated detections of specific signatures. These capabilities are necessary, but alone are not sufficient, for a challengee such as IED detection. NRL and others have been developing real-time high-bandwidth wrieless communications and techniques for fusion of optical products with non-optical data in net-centric architectures.
